Once you’ve finished sanding, clean the surface with a tack cloth or compressed air to remove the dust. Use distilled water to lightly dampen the surface of the butcher block. Allow it to dry. Once it’s dry, sand the butcher block lightly with 150-grit sandpaper so that the surface feels smooth.

Web14 nov. 2012 · Here's a good rule of thumb to treating counter tops that we've been sticking to. After you install your counters, make sure you get everything sanded and looking the way you want, then start with your oil. Apply your oil: Once per day for the first week. Once per week for the first month. Once per month for the life of the counters.
